aide demandée Créer des VST
- 16 réponses
- 9 participants
- 3 561 vues
- 9 followers
g@by
Je ne sais pas si je suis dans la bonne section ni sur le bon site, mais vos réponses chaleureuses à mes précédents postes me pousse à vous reposer une petite question
La question est dans le titre : je cherche à créer mes propres VST (plug in d'effet) (EQ et compresseur, pour commencer).
Bien évidement, je ne part pas de rien. Je suis d'une part étudiant ingénieur civil et d'autre part passionner de musique. J'ai eu la chance dans mon cursus d'avoir eu des cours de programmation en C (et C++), des cours d’algorithmie, d'analyse numérique et bien sure des cours de mathématiques et de physiques.
Je cherche donc une base (un livre, un bon site, de bon tuto, votre savoir (surtout
Je cherche également des codes en C++ (d'algorithmes DSP) pour avoir une idée de l'implémentation.
PS : Je ne cherche pas à avoir les codes sources de Waves ou UAD, je me doute que ce genre de chose est gardé secret.
g@by
Toxikalien
Je me souvient plus trop tous ce qui y avait..... J'étais tomber dessus en cherchant sur google : remonte control vst mais jsais plus le site que j'ai regardé car j'en ai regardé plein......
jojolaricot https://soundcloud.com/toxikalien/track-2
Toxikalien
jojolaricot https://soundcloud.com/toxikalien/track-2
j.ThierryG
A part la piste des SDK proposés par Steinberg https://www.steinberg.net/en/company/developers.html ou autres comme Juce https://en.wikipedia.org/wiki/JUCE je n'ai pas l'expérience pour te suggérer quoi que ce soit d'autre.
boulooban
g@by
Pour l'instant je ne m’intéresse pas vraiment au synthé mais merci à toi Toxikalien pour l'info qui pourrait m'être utile si je me décide à faire des synth (je n'ai pas su retombé sur le site que tu proposes, si tu retrouves le lien un jour fait moi signe
J'ai regardé également "Synthedit" que boulooban propose, ce n'est pas exactement ce que je cherche, par contre, ca à l'air assez cool pour ceux qui veulent créer leur synthé virtuel sans mettre les mains dans du "code"
Merci à toi j.ThierryG, j'ai fait quelques recherches sur google, et c'est exactement ce que je cherche
En fouillant un peu sur Youtube, j'ai pu tombé sur ca : (peut être que ca intéressera d'autre AFiens)
(Une autre vidéo plus explicative existe)
Pour l'instant je n'ai pas plus de renseignement que cette vidéo pour me lancer dans du code...
Voilà, si vous avez d'autres "tuto", info pratiques, algo, méthodes,... N'hésitez pas à nourrir ce poste !!
Anonyme
Y'a un espace du forum kvr dédié au développement de plugin "DSP and Plug-In Development" :
https://www.kvraudio.com/forum/viewforum.php?f=33
Ils organisent même des concours de développement
https://www.kvraudio.com/kvr-developer-challenge/2014/
Sinon, y'avait un article sur Usine récemment sur AF qui permet notamment de développer ses propres plug (en C++ je crois avec un environnement dédié). On cite d'autres soft dans la discussion, je te laisse y jeter un oeil :
https://fr.audiofanzine.com/sequenceur-modulaire/sensomusic/usine-hollyhock-ii-pro/forums/t.594249,commentaires-sur-le-test-la-sortie-de-l-usine-a-sens.html
Jimbass
http://lv2plug.in/pages/developing.html
Musikmesser 2013 - Bullshit Gourous - Tocxic Instruments - festivals Foud'Rock, Metal Sphère et la Tour met les Watts
g@by
Anonyme
pour en revenir à synthedit, tu peux aussi ajouter du code... ne m'en demande pas plus, je ne code pas.
delchambre
tu peux essayer ceci, si tu connais le c/c++/c#/javascript tu t'en sortiras sans problème le reste c'est de l'algo audio et là ce sera à toi de jouer.
ça permet de prototyper des plugins facilement en basant ton énergie sur les algos et non sur les interfaces, environnement etc ...
https://www.bluecataudio.com/Products/Product_PlugNScript/
pour ce qui est des algos, de bonnes bases sont dispos ici :
Khohd (Post Metal / Post Rock)
Vieux machins et autres trucs persos: remix&versions persos - Compos et Compotines AF - Mixages "blues/jazz/rock" - Vidéos kitch
Anonyme
WDL est une bibliothèque développée par Cockos qu'ils utilisent notamment pour développer reaper.
WDL-ol est une extension de WDL réalisée par un certain Oli Larkin qui intègre des bibliothèques de iPlug (
). Je crois qu'on peut exporter en vst, AU, pour PC ou mac, en stand-alone ou plug-in, etcSources : https://github.com/olilarkin/wdl-ol
Un tutoriel : http://www.martin-finke.de/blog/tags/making_audio_plugins.html
Exemple de plug-in réalisés avec WDL-ol :
https://forum.cockos.com/showthread.php?s=eba3ddac9efb7a175841dda6347921d7&t=122276
D'ailleurs, il semble y avoir de très bons vst gratuits/pas cher dans le lien ci-dessus...
Un des problèmes avec Juce est que c'est sous licence GPL, ce qui oblige à distribuer l'intégralité du code source si on distribue un plug-in réalisé avec Juce. Or pour réaliser un vst, il faut utiliser des bibliothèques VST SDK distribuées par Steinberg dont la licence interdit de distribuer le code source... Autrement dit, on ne peut pas distribuer des vst réalisés avec Juce, ou alors il faut acheter une licence commercial de Juce.
WDL-Ol ne présente pas ce problème de licence.
[ Dernière édition du message le 20/06/2015 à 19:42:30 ]
Anonyme
Citation :
Oli Larkin
il a été (et il est toujours ?) actif dans la création de modules sur synthedit.
Anonyme
Anonyme
Anonyme
une version un peu allégée de flowstone est incluse dans flstudio (ça pt êt déjà été dit).
- < Liste des sujets
- Charte